欢迎光临连南能五网络有限公司司官网!
全国咨询热线:13768600254
当前位置: 首页 > 新闻动态

PHP中解析并访问存储为JSON字符串的数组值

时间:2025-11-28 17:41:11

PHP中解析并访问存储为JSON字符串的数组值
在问题描述中提到collections.defaultdict可以正常序列化,即使其变量名与类名有大小写差异。
闭包能捕获并持续访问外层函数变量,如counter函数中count被递增且生命周期延长至堆;闭包引用变量而非值拷贝,循环中易因共享i导致所有闭包输出相同值。
这是我在实际开发中经常需要强调的点,因为这两者是相辅相成的。
根据需要调整路由和中间件,以满足项目的特定需求。
在我看来,类和对象的关系,就像是“模具”和“铸件”一样。
如果存在长度超过目标长度的列表,则需要进行额外的处理,例如截断列表。
立即学习“PHP免费学习笔记(深入)”; 感知哈希算法(pHash):更鲁棒的选择 感知哈希算法(pHash)是一种更高级的方法,它通过一系列步骤将图像转换为一个唯一的“指纹”,然后比较这些指纹的相似度。
在我看来,PHAR就是为那些追求“开箱即用”体验的PHP应用而生的。
1. 链接时机不同:编译期 vs 运行期 静态链接库在程序编译链接阶段就被完整地复制到可执行文件中。
比如,一个函数内部创建并返回一个新对象,或者一个容器存储着它独有的元素,都非常适合用unique_ptr。
例如: func modifySlice(s []int) {     s[0] = 999 } func main() {     data := []int{1, 2, 3}     modifySlice(data)     fmt.Println(data) // 输出 [999 2 3] } 虽然没有用指针,但 s 和 data 共享底层数组,所以修改生效。
示例:定义一个加法函数 假设我们需要定义一个名为 addStuff 的函数,该函数接收两个整数作为参数,并返回它们的和。
微软爱写作 微软出品的免费英文写作/辅助/批改/评分工具 17 查看详情 引入事件驱动通信 微服务间通过事件实现最终一致性: 命令执行成功后发布领域事件到消息队列 其他服务或本服务的查询侧监听事件并更新对应视图 保证高可用的同时降低服务间直接依赖 比如用户注册完成后发送“UserRegistered”事件,通知通知服务和推荐服务各自更新状态。
错误处理: 良好的错误处理是健壮程序的基石。
性能对比总结 从快到慢排序: Protobuf(最快,推荐RPC场景) MessagePack(平衡性能与灵活性) Gob(Go内部通信可用) JSON(调试友好,性能最低) 若追求极致性能且接受代码生成,Protobuf是首选。
掌握指针遍历的关键是理解指针算术和数组内存布局。
find 函数: 接收一个 [][]int32 类型的 packet 和一个 UnpackerMaker 类型的函数。
$result = []: 初始化一个空数组 $result,用于存储找到的所有值。
结构体可导出字段: 只有结构体的可导出(首字母大写)字段才能被Gob或JSON Codec正确序列化和反序列化。
")代码解释: np.random.rand(100, 20) 和 np.random.rand(100) 分别生成随机矩阵 G 和向量 h。

本文链接:http://www.veneramodels.com/292712_9258b3.html